Ministry for Reintegration of the Temporary Occupied Territories delivers humanitarian aid to university evacuated from Mariupol
On April 26, the Ministry for Reintegration of the Temporarily Occupied Territories of Ukraine, together with the international humanitarian organization WorldCentral Kitchen, delivered humanitarian aid to the Donetsk State University of Internal Affairs, which has now moved from Mariupol to Kryvyy Rih.
The cargo, in particular, included 250 food packages (15 kg each) and other foodstaffs. Appropriate assistance will provide the priority humanitarian needs of more than 350 cadets and academic staff of the educational institution.
Background
Currently, the Ministry for Reintegration of the Temporary Occupied Territories together with partners is developing a concept of a special platform, which aims to focus on the organization of assistance and support to the residents of Mariupol.
It should be noted in order to provide the necessary assistance in a systematic, timely and high-quality manner, international and Ukrainian charitable foundations, volunteers, donors from abroad, local and regional self-government bodies, the Government and the Parliament are involved.
